Overview

A combination of **JNJ-74856665**, an orally bioavailable, potent, and selective dihydroorotate dehydrogenase (DHODH) inhibitor, and **azacitidine**, a nucleoside metabolic inhibitor. JNJ-74856665 binds the enzyme’s ubiquinone-binding site, promoting differentiation of leukemic cells, cell cycle arrest, and apoptosis, while azacitidine inhibits DNA methyltransferase and is FDA-approved for certain myelodysplastic syndrome (MDS) subtypes. This combination is being developed as an investigational regimen for the treatment of hematological malignancies including acute myeloid leukemia (AML), MDS, and chronic myelomonocytic leukemia (CMML), and is currently under evaluation in early-phase clinical trials[2][3][4][5][7][6].
